I just got back from attending my first Dallas VSTS User Group Meeting. Vince Blasberg gave a presentation titled "Reporting in Visual Studio Team System." He gave a great deep dive into the database architecture around TFS, the Data Warehouse and the OLAP Services. Vince also had some great tips on how custom work item field attributes can affect reporting as well as learning resources around building TFS Reports. I'm hoping we do a deep dive around mining the Data Warehouse for dashboard data reporting. It was great first experience with the group.
